Sinopsis Fear the Night: What's the Buzz About?
Okay, so Fear the Night is one of those movies that throws you right into the thick of things. The basic premise revolves around a bachelorette party that goes horribly, horribly wrong. You know, the kind of wrong that involves masked intruders and a whole lot of fighting for survival. Think home invasion thriller meets kick-ass female lead.
The sinopsis often highlights the main character, Tess, played by the ever-so-talented Maggie Q. Tess is an Iraq War veteran with a troubled past, trying to keep it together while attending her sister's bachelorette party. What starts as a fun getaway at a secluded farmhouse quickly turns into a nightmare when a group of masked men break in, turning the celebration into a desperate fight for survival. Decoding the Plot of Fear the Night
Alright, let’s dive deeper into the plot of Fear the Night. So, the movie kicks off with what seems like a typical bachelorette party – a group of women gathering at a remote farmhouse to celebrate their soon-to-be-married friend. There’s laughter, drinks are flowing, and the vibe is generally festive. But beneath the surface, there are undercurrents of personal struggles and past traumas, particularly for our main protagonist, Tess. This sets the stage for the chaos that’s about to unfold.
The tension starts to build subtly. We see glimpses of Tess’s PTSD, hinting at her military background and the demons she’s still battling. This adds a layer of depth to her character, making her more than just your average action hero. Then, BAM! The masked intruders arrive, shattering the idyllic facade and plunging the party into a desperate fight for survival. The intruders aren't just random thugs; they’re organized, ruthless, and have a clear objective, though their motivations are initially shrouded in mystery. This immediately raises the stakes and forces the women to band together if they want to make it through the night.
As the night progresses, the plot thickens. We learn more about the intruders and their motives, which adds a whole new dimension to the story. There are twists and turns, moments of genuine suspense, and some seriously intense action sequences. Tess, drawing on her military training and inner strength, takes charge, turning the farmhouse into a battleground. It’s not just about physical combat, though; there’s a psychological element at play too, as Tess tries to outsmart the intruders and protect her friends. Fear the Night Review: Is It Worth Watching?
Now for the big question: Is Fear the Night worth watching? In my humble opinion, the answer is a resounding yes, especially if you're a fan of thrillers with strong female leads and intense action. Maggie Q delivers a stellar performance as Tess, bringing both vulnerability and badassery to the role. You genuinely root for her as she navigates the terrifying situation, and her portrayal of a woman grappling with her past while fighting for her survival is compelling.
The movie isn't without its flaws, of course. Some might find the plot a bit predictable at times, and there are moments where you have to suspend your disbelief a little. But honestly, the strengths of Fear the Night far outweigh its weaknesses. The pacing is excellent, keeping you on the edge of your seat from the moment the intruders arrive until the final showdown. The action sequences are well-choreographed and visceral, and the tension is palpable throughout the film. Plus, the supporting cast does a solid job of bringing their characters to life, making you care about the fate of the women trapped in the farmhouse.
What really sets Fear the Night apart is its focus on character development. It's not just a mindless action flick; it delves into the emotional and psychological toll of violence, particularly on Tess. Her PTSD and past traumas are woven into the narrative, adding depth and complexity to her character. This makes her journey all the more compelling, and her ultimate triumph feels genuinely earned.
